Output e26c1bfc5a9a1968901468786f1dbf899e9aec5702d2c55ff5b9349466a53bd0:1

value
9967947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4341e0a62658de84d700d1796730b1a372729c8 OP_EQUAL
address
3M33cPV7N8WgUf5LasSuGJR7ASkhioXjtt
transaction
e26c1bfc5a9a1968901468786f1dbf899e9aec5702d2c55ff5b9349466a53bd0
confirmations
391732
spent
true